The Signs Your Pipes Need Relining

If you’re unsure whether or not your pipes need relining, here’s the signs to watch out for:

  • Water leakage
  • Bad odors coming from your drains
  • Gurgling noises coming from your dr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Is It Best To Have My Pipes Replaced or Relined?

This is a question homeowners from all walks of life will have to consider at some point. Relining and replacement both are a choice with advantages and disadvantages. It can be difficult to choose which option is best for you. Here are a few concerns to take into consideration:

Relining

  • Relining is less expensive than replacing.
  • It’s possible without tearing the floor or walls.
  • It is feasible to do it fast, usually in a day or two.
  • There is less of a mess to clean up after the project is completed.
  • The new liner is expected to last for many years.

Replacement

  • Relining is more expensive than relining.
  • It can be a messy job and you might need to leave your house for a few days during the time it’s being done.
  • The new pipe should last for many years.

Is It Possible To Reline Pipes That Have Bends In Them?

The trenchless pipe relining process is a great no dig solution to repair damaged pipes that have bends in their walls. The process of pipe relining creates a new pipe in the existing pipe. This means that you don’t have to remove the old pipe, and you are able to repair it without having to dig up your yard or driveway.

The difficulty of a pipe relining project grows with more bends within the pipe. Our experts have lined many sewer lines with bends in them.

Although it is a challenge, it’s not impossible and we’ve got the knowledge and know-how to get the job done correctly.

Can Collapsed Pipes Be Relined?

We are unable to reline the pipe that has collapsed. If you’ve suffered a collapsed pipe then you’ll require replacing the pipe in its entirety. If you are not sure what the damage is to your pipe you can have us come out to conduct an inspection for you.

Will Pipe Relining Reduce Pipe Flow?

There is usually no decrease in the pipe’s flow due to pipe relining. In fact, pipe relining can increase your flow through the pipe because it creates an entirely new and smooth surface for water through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Around?

Pipe relining was used for many years, beginning with the first recorded instance dating back to 1854. It was only in the early 2000’s that it was beginning to be more commonly used.

The technology of pipe relining is widely used around the globe as a successful way to repair leaks or damaged pipes, without the need to dig them up and replace them entirely. There are numerous types of pipe relining services that can be employed, depending on the type of pipe as well as the severity of what the issue is.

There is, for instance, spot pipe relining Vermont South, which is utilised for leaks of a small size, and structural pipe relining, that is utilised for more severe damage. Whatever type of pipe relining technique is employed in the process, the focus is the same: fixing the pipe without replacing it entirely.
